harvard extension school login: what to check first

To log in to Harvard Extension School, go to extension.harvard.edu/login and use your MyDCE student account with either a DCEKey (for new students) or HarvardKey (for returning students after registering for a course). New students must first create a MyDCE account before accessing course registration, Canvas, grades, and student finance.

Understanding the Harvard Extension School Login System

Harvard Extension School operates under Harvard's Division of Continuing Education (DCE), which uses the MyDCE student portal as the central hub for all student activities. This portal provides personalized access to your student account, enabling you to update profile information, complete pre-registration, access course registration, view your schedule, and connect to Canvas for course websites.

The login system distinguishes between two credential types based on your student status. New students create a DCEKey credential using a personal email address, while returning students who have registered for courses receive a HarvardKey within 24-48 hours after registration.

Step-by-Step Login Process for New Students

Following the official Harvard Extension School enrollment workflow ensures you avoid common pitfalls that delay access to course materials.

  1. Navigate to extension.harvard.edu and click the MyDCE login tab at the top of the page
  2. Select "Create a MyDCE student account" if you are new to DCE
  3. Enter your email address (recommended: personal email, not work/school), password, name, date of birth, and phone number
  4. Confirm your email address using the verification link sent to your inbox
  5. Log in using your newly created DCEKey credentials
  6. Complete the pre-registration process to confirm biographical and contact information before term start
  7. After registering for your first course, wait 24-48 hours to claim your HarvardKey at Key.Harvard.edu

Step-by-Step Login Process for Returning Students

Returning students have streamlined access since they already possess established credentials from prior enrollment.

  1. Go to extension.harvard.edu/login
  2. Click the MyDCE login tab
  3. Log in using your HarvardKey (primary credential) or DCEKey
  4. Complete pre-registration for the new term to confirm your contact information
  5. Access your dashboard to register for courses, view finances, or link to Canvas

Common Login Issues and Troubleshooting

Technical problems frequently prevent successful logins, but most resolve quickly with targeted troubleshooting.

Issue Cause Solution
Cannot create account Browser compatibility or firewall blocking Try a different browser; use computer not phone
No HarvardKey yet haven't registered for course Register first; HarvardKey arrives 24-48 hours later
Email verification not received Work/school email blocked by firewall Use personal email address permanently
Forgot password Credential reset needed Contact Enrollment Services at 617-495-4024
Canvas login fails Using wrong credential type Must use HarvardKey for course websites

What You Can Access After Logging In

The MyDCE portal serves as your comprehensive student account hub with access to all essential academic services.

  • Update personal profile information and contact details
  • Complete pre-registration each term (required before course registration)
  • Access course registration and submit your schedule
  • View your student finance portal and payment options
  • Access Canvas course websites (via dashboard link or Canvas.Harvard.edu)
  • View your course schedule
  • Take placement tests through Online Services
  • View grades and request transcripts
  • See important school announcements

Contact Information for Login Assistance

When self-troubleshooting fails, Enrollment Services provides direct support for account creation and login problems.

For enrollment services assistance with login issues, call 617-495-4024 Monday-Friday, 9 a.m.-5 p.m. Eastern Time, or email Inquiry@Extension.Harvard.edu. For academic technology issues specifically (Canvas, HarvardKey), call 617-998-8571 with extended hours: Monday-Thursday 10 a.m.-11 p.m., Friday-Sunday 10 a.m.-8 p.m. ET.

What credentials do I need to log in?

You need either a DCEKey (email + password created by new students) or a HarvardKey (University-issued credential for returning students). HarvardKey becomes your primary login after you register for your first course and receive your Harvard University ID number.

How long does it take to get my HarvardKey?

HarvardKeys are available to claim 24 to 48 hours after you register for a course and receive your Harvard University ID number. You will receive an email about claiming your HarvardKey within 48 hours of registering for your first course.

What email address should I use for my account?

We recommend using a personal email address that you have permanent access to, rather than a work or school email, as institutional firewalls may block Harvard emails.

Can I use my work email for my MyDCE account?

No, we recommend using a personal email address rather than work or school email, as institutional firewall settings may block Harvard Summer School and Extension School emails.

Where do I access my course website after logging in?

Course websites are hosted on Canvas and can be accessed directly at Canvas.Harvard.edu using your HarvardKey, or by logging into MyDCE and clicking the Canvas link from your Dashboard.
